Indian Scientists Develop Nano-Materials Based Security Ink To Combat Counterfeiting Of Currency, Branded Goods Indian Scientist

Institute of Nano Science and Technology, Mohali, an autonomous institute under the Department of Science & Technology, Government of India, has developed non-toxic metal phosphate-based ink with excitation dependant luminescent properties which are highly stable under practical conditions such as temperature, humidity and light, etc.

For the first time in the Major Ports in India, Radio over Internet Protocol system inaugurated at Syama Prasad Mookerjee Port

In view of a much needed solution for providing effective long range Marine communication, the Radio over Internet Protocol (ROIP) System at Syama Prasad Mookerjee Port, Kolkata (SMP, Kolkata), was inaugurated.

ROIP system is being introduced as a marine communication mode, for the first time in any Major Indian Port.

Indo-Canadian Anita Anand appointed Canada’s defence minister

Indo-Canadian Anita Anand became just the second woman to be appointed Canada’s minister of national defence as Prime Minister Justin Trudeau announced his new cabinet.

The ministers were sworn in by governor-general Mary May Simon in a ceremony at Rideau Hall in Ottawa.

She is the first woman to serve as defence minister since Kim Campbell in the 1990s.

Indo-Pacific Regional Dialogue commences from October 27 for 3 days

First conducted in 2018, the Indo-Pacific Regional Dialogue (IPRD) is the apex international annual conference of the Indian Navy, and is the principal manifestation of the navy’s engagement at the strategic-level.

The National Maritime Foundation is the navy’s knowledge partner and chief organiser of each edition of this annual event.

75th Infantry Day: IAF remembers role of 'Parashurama' aircraft in transporting army troops to J-K in 1947

To commemorate the 75th Infantry Day on 27 October, The Indian Air Force recalled the history of vintage aircraft 'Parashurama'-- one of the refurbished Dakotas-- that played a major role in transporting troops of the 1st Sikh Regiment to Srinagar during the war with Pakistan in 1947.

It is also remembered as the first military event of Independent India.
